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)1. Can I drive in Germany with a foreign driving license?
Yes, visitors can drive in Germany with a valid foreign driving license for approximately 6 months. After that, they might require to get a German driving license.
2. What is the credibility duration of a German driving license?
A German driving license usually has a validity of 15 years, after which it should be restored.
